Government failure is likely to occur for all of the following reasons except:

A. intervention in markets is always simpler than it initially seems.
B. special interest groups might lobby government to the detriment of the public good.
C. the bureaucratic nature of government intervention does not allow fine-tuning.
D. individuals have better information about a situation that affects them than does government.


Answer: A
